> > DC real-time DC-offset correction has been a part of the "standard" FGPA > image for most USRPs since the USRP2. With UHD "Traditional" > (Non-RFNoC) you can turn it off. Not sure how you accomplish that with > RFNoC. >
Since the X310 uses the external CSV calibration file to set the DC offset, perhaps this operation of manually setting a value also disables the automatic correction?? Or, perhaps I am fooling myself into thinking that the correction typically remains static on this device. In any case, I was able to disable the correction in my rfnoc project by setting the appropriate field in the property_tree. The following shows the tree entry assuming mboard=0, radio=0, port=0: /mboards/0/xbar/Radio_0/rx_fe_corrections/0/dc_offset/enable
